Meet Madame Lorbinenko

By Cathie Murphy

October 23, 2007

Madame Lorbinenko has been teaching at Stillman Valley High School for over twenty years. She graduated from the University of Illinois with an undergraduate degree in French Education. While at the university she took advantage of the junior year abroad program and studied at the Sorbonne University in Paris, France. She has also earned a masters degree from NIU in Curriculum and Supervision. Madame teaches French I, II, II, and IV and taught world history for over twelve years. She sponsors French Club and over the years she has led a dozen trips to Paris with her French students. She is also the National Honor Society sponsor, a facilitor for the Fine Arts/Foreign Language Department and has been a co-chairman of the North Central Association, an accreditation organization, for the last ten years. Madame Lorbinenko is married to Wally Krebs and they have two children, Harrison and Alexandria.
